I am sure if you found the exact Fuzz Face Jimi Hendrix actually used and his exact Marshall and exact Strat, half the guys who plugged into this rig would hate it.
anything (fuzzface) with germs in it runs the risk of shite tone. period the end. Jimi was known to go through an entire box of units and maybe find one he liked.
Seems like Fuzz Faces are real finnicky about what pedals are in front and behind them, too. :(

While we're on Fuzz Faces, the MXR Classic Fuzz works great with wahs. Jeorge from Way Huge designed it. I have a Marshall SupaFuzz clone and I tried it after my wah last night and the wah total disappeared. All I got when I stepped on it was a volume boost. I usually run it before the wah and my Muff after. I had the Ox Fuzz for about a week and it was KILLER. He really does one of the best FF's out there. Lots and lots of sustain, nasty and thick and it did work with a wah.
